Why doesn't InPage text display correctly when pasted on websites or in MS Word? expand_more
InPage was originally engineered in the 1990s using proprietary 1-byte font encodings (such as Noori Nastaleeq) rather than the international UTF-8 Unicode standard. When you paste raw text from InPage directly into web browsers, MS Word, or social media, the system interprets the character codes as English letters or broken ASCII symbols. Converting the text through our tool translates those proprietary codes into standard Unicode codepoints.

Is the conversion 100% accurate for all documents? expand_more
Our converter maps all 39+ standard Urdu alphabets, compound aspirated letters (دو چشمی ہ مرکبات), Arabic diacritics (اعراب), Urdu numerals (۰-۹), and traditional punctuation marks (، ؛ ؟ ۔). While standard prose and articles convert with high accuracy, we always recommend reviewing complex poetry or rare Persian/Arabic religious ligatures prior to final offset printing.
